#917183 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#917183 is composed of 56.9% red, 44.3%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.1% magenta, 9.7%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 326.3 degrees, a saturation of 12.7% and a lightness of 50.6%. #917183 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e2ff with #230007.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

● #917183 color description : Dark grayish pink.
#917183 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#917183 has RGB values of R:145, G:113,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.1,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 9531779.
